A generalized methodology of constructing a Mexican hat wavelet family involving even order Gaussian derivatives has been devised in a Gaussian scale space only. The optimization has been carried out in Fourier domain and the kernels in Gaussian scale space domain are found to be exact replica of their derivative wavelet counterpart for low as well as high order. Exploiting the models of human visual system based on Gaussian derivatives and their non-localization property in spectral domain, a new design of low pass filter is proposed in this work. The filter is designed by a weighted combination of the Gaussian derivative family which makes the passband of this filter almost equiripple.
